Understanding the Current Landscape of AI
To grasp the future of artificial intelligence, it is essential to recognize its current state. AI technologies today encompass various capabilities and applications:
- Machine Learning: Algorithms that enable systems to learn from data without explicit programming.
- Natural Language Processing: Technologies that allow machines to understand human language, such as chatbots and virtual assistants.
- Computer Vision: The ability for computers to interpret and make decisions based on visual data.
- Robotics: Machines designed to perform tasks ranging from manufacturing to personal assistance.
How AI Will Transform Industries
The integration of AI into various sectors is projected to enhance efficiency, reduce costs, and create new opportunities. Here are some key industries and their expected transformations:
Healthcare
AI is set to revolutionize healthcare through:
- Diagnostic Accuracy: AI algorithms can analyze medical images, improving diagnosis rates of conditions such as cancer.
- Personalized Medicine: Machine learning models will analyze patientsβ genetic data to recommend tailored treatment plans.
- Predictive Analytics: AI will forecast disease outbreaks and patient admission rates, aiding resource planning.
Finance
In finance, AI will enhance operations by:
- Fraud Detection: Real-time analysis of transaction patterns will identify anomalies and prevent fraud.
- Algorithmic Trading: AI systems will execute trades based on predictive analytics, optimizing investment strategies.
- Customer Service: Automated support systems like chatbots will handle inquiries, increasing client satisfaction.
Transportation
Transportation will evolve with AI through:
- Autonomous Vehicles: Self-driving cars will enhance safety and reduce traffic congestion.
- Traffic Management: AI systems will optimize traffic flow based on real-time data.
- Logistics Optimization: AI will improve supply chain efficiency through predictive analytics and route optimization.
Challenges and Ethical Considerations
Despite its potential, the future of artificial intelligence poses significant challenges that require careful consideration:
Data Privacy
As AI systems rely heavily on data, ensuring data privacy is essential. Organizations must develop frameworks that protect user information while utilizing AI.
Bias in AI Models
AI systems can perpetuate or exacerbate biases present in training data. Addressing this issue will involve:
- Diverse Data Sets: Utilizing varied and representative datasets to train AI models.
- Regular Audits: Conducting assessments of AI outputs for discriminatory patterns.
Job Displacement
The automation of tasks previously performed by humans may lead to job displacement. Solutions include:
- Reskilling Programs: Initiatives to retrain workers to acquire skills relevant to evolving job markets.
- Universal Basic Income: Exploring social safety nets to support those affected by job losses.
The Role of Regulation in AI Development
To harness the benefits of AI while mitigating risks, establishing regulatory frameworks is crucial. Key elements of effective regulation include:
Transparency and Accountability
AI systems should be transparent in their operations. Regulations must enforce accountability for AI-generated decisions, particularly in critical areas like healthcare and law enforcement.
Collaboration with Experts
Governments should engage with AI professionals, ethicists, and affected communities when crafting regulations. This collaboration ensures regulations are practical and sensitive to societal needs.
The Future of Human-AI Collaboration
As AI evolves, the relationship between humans and machines will transform. Future developments may include:
Augmented Intelligence
Rather than replacing humans, AI will augment human decision-making and creativity. This collaboration can lead to:
- Improved Problem-Solving: Humans can leverage AI insights to make informed decisions.
- Enhanced Creativity: AI tools can assist artists and writers, facilitating new forms of creativity.
Emotional AI
Advancements in emotional AI will enable machines to understand and respond to human emotions. This development can lead to:
- Better Customer Interactions: Emotional AI can create empathetic customer service experiences.
- Supportive Companionship: Robots equipped with emotional AI can provide companionship to the elderly and individuals with disabilities.
